National Security Emerging Markets Index ETF
ETF Overview
Overview
The National Security Emerging Markets Index ETF seeks to provide investment results that correspond generally to the price and yield performance, before fees and expenses, of the National Security Emerging Markets Index. The fund focuses on emerging market equities while considering national security risks.

Competitive Landscape
The emerging markets ETF space is dominated by large, established funds. This fund distinguishes itself via screening based on national security considerations. Its competitive advantages are its focus on national security. The disadvantage is the fund will likely exhibit increased tracking error due to additional screening.

About National Security Emerging Markets Index ETF

The fund invests at least 80% of its total assets in component securities of the index. The index consists of stocks listed on globally recognized stock exchanges that excludes companies benefiting end-users that, in the view of the sponsor of the fund, National Security Index, LLC (the "Sponsor") pose a threat to the national security interests of the United States.
